AFTV star Troopz has riled up fans after calling parents who buy their children McDonald's breakfast before school a 'disgrace'.

The former Arsenal Fan TV presenter, 36 - real name Aumar Hamilton - caused commotion on X when he dubbed a woman a 'wrong 'un' for allowing her eight-year-old daughter to eat the popular fast food breakfast before class.

The British personality and father-of-two further explained that his disappointment stemmed from the child looking like she weighed 'over 10 stone'.

The rant wasn't well received by his followers who quickly pointed out his own untoward habits as they claimed he 'smoked w**d in front of his children'.

Meanwhile others painted a picture of what it was like to raise children, adding that parental challenges sometimes called for allowing them a 'treat' before school.

Taking to X he wrote: 'I’m sorry, if you are buying your child McDonald’s breakfast before school, you are an absolute DISGRACE!!

'I [have] just seen some woman and her kid eating one, kid [is] about eight-years-old and already weighs over 10 stone. The mum [is] a wrong 'un'.

According to Collins Dictionary, a wrong 'un is a dishonest or unscrupulous person - exactly what Troopz claimed the unknown woman was for buying McDonald's for a child before school started.

People flocked to the post to give Troopz a piece of their mind, and while the comments appeared largely divided - many were unimpressed by his statement.

Hitting back at the presenter, one person wrote: 'But you smoke w**d in front of yours??'

'Brother you be smoking w**d in front of yours' agreed another.

One user made a similar comment: 'You smoke w**d and constantly cuss in front of your kids'.

In an interview with earlier this year, the personality revealed that he began 'smoking w**d at age 10'. However it has been not confirmed whether he ever did this in front of his children.

Elsewhere some parents defended their actions, saying they were perfectly within their rights to give their children a 'treat'. 

'I buy my kids one once in blue moon. It not a disgrace if it not often and as treat' explained one person.

One woman wrote: 'As a Jamaican to another Jamaican… Try being a mum for a week! That too with a toddler. You’d probably give up if you had to switch roles with me.

'While I [have] never tried McDonald’s breakfast for my daughter, but I do it as a treat or on days when she doesn’t want anything else. Ain’t nothing wrong with parents who do this!'

A third told Troopz not to 'judge': 'While it's not good to do [it] everyday, it could be for a reward for something the child did. Don't judge until you know the full story'. 

Troopz, whose mother is from Jamaica and father from Pakistan and Morocco, made his name during the early days of the AFTV channel - then known as Arsenal Fan TV - when he was a vocal critic of Arsene Wenger. 

He remains a regular presence in regards to Arsenal matters online - but is no longer a regular contributor to AFTV - and now works for US company Barstool Sports.
